Django REST Mock

Mock Express server generated based on your views, that can come in handy when developing REST APIs with Django.

Requirements

Requires Django 1.11 or later and Node.js.

Installation

Using pip:

$ pip install django-rest-mock

Then include rest_mock_server into your INSTALLED_APPS:

INSTALLED_APPS = (
    ...
    'rest_mock_server',
    ...
)

Usage

Generates an ExpressJS file:

$ python manage.py genmockserver

Starts an ExpressJS server (it will generate an ExpressJS file if necessary):

$ python manage.py startmockserver [--file]

–file (Optional): Specifies ExpressJS file to be used

Example

Let’s say you have an app with the following views.py, you will need to include the following syntax in your docstrings:

class SomeView(APIView):
    """
    URL: /some-view/
    """

    def get(self, request, *args, **kwargs):
        """
        ```
        {
            "data": "Hello, world!"
        }
        ```
        """
        pass

And then you run python manage.py genmockserver, you will get an index.js generated in your current directory
